  4. They should fit just fine assuming you haven't made any changes to the brake system such as a significantly larger caliper. Many people run these wheels on their S30s as well as the smaller 14" 5 spoke version that came on the non-turbo 81-83 ZX. You should be able to run up to a 225/50/15 without any rub even on a 280Z lowered 1-2 inches.

    Perhaps a bad plug operating intermittently, a leaky plug wire, dirty terminals, a cracked or tracing disti cap. That could explain what's holding you back. Time to check all the wires, clean up the terminals and inspect the cap. Switching the plug to another cylinder might help isolate whether it's the plug, wire, connections or cap if all else fails.
